Harrisons Holdings (Malaysia) Bhd  (XKLS:5008) 1-Year Sharpe Ratio Explanation

The 1-Year Sharpe Ratio inidicates the risk-adjusted return of an investment over the past year. It is calculated as the annualized result of the average monthly excess return divided by its standard deviation over the past year. The monthly excess return is the monthly investment return minus the monthly risk-free rate (typically the 10-year Treasury Constant Maturity Rate). If the risk-free rate for a specific region is not available, U.S. data is used by default.

The greater a portfolio's Sharpe Ratio, the better its risk-adjusted performance. A negative Sharpe Ratio means the risk-free rate is greater than the portfolio’s historical or projected return, or else the portfolio's return is expected to be negative.

Harrisons Holdings (Malaysia) Bhd Business Description

Address 10, Jalan Raja Laut, Unit 9A, 9th Floor, Wisma Bumi Raya, Wisma Bumi Raya, Kuala Lumpur, MYS, 50350
Harrisons Holdings (Malaysia) Bhd is a sale, marketing, warehousing, distribution, and services organization in Malaysia. The Group operates in four key geographical segments within Malaysia, namely Sabah, Sarawak, Peninsular Malaysia and Others. The Sabah, Sarawak and Peninsular Malaysia segments comprise the trading and distribution of consumer products, building materials, industrial and agricultural chemical products, as well as the provision of insurance and shipping services within their respective geographical markets. The Others segment includes the trading and distribution of liquor products, as well as the provision of travel agency services, property rental, and the retailing of consumer goods.
